Every business needs commercial property insurance. It protects your building and property inside the building, as well as fences, outdoor signs, and other exterior fixtures. But if you live in a flood zone or an area prone to earthquakes or other natural disasters, commercial property insurance may not be enough. You may need to purchase additional specialty disaster insurance to provide the protection your business needs.

Some locations are more likely to experience natural disasters than others. If your business is located in such an area, specialty disaster insurance may be an essential inclusion in your business insurance package. Your business package should be designed to cover indirect costs of a disaster – disruption of your business – in addition to the costs of repairing, rebuilding, or replacing your business property.
